The Big Picture
Zach Lahn and Rob Sand are projected to face each other in the race for Iowa governor in November. Lahn secured his position by winning the state's GOP primary, defeating Trump-backed Randy Feenstra. Sand is expected to be Lahn's opponent in the general election.
